In his final years he teaches AuRon wisdom and languages. In the writing he is shown to have a failing mind and little distinction between long term and short term memory, possibly due to the effects of prolonged exposure to a mysterious crystal he guards. He later dies fighting AuRon during one such lapse when AuRon is forced to trick NooMoahk into impaling himself on a monument dedicated to the elder dragon's late human friend Tindairus. It is possible that he is an ancestor of the siblings. They came about during the first dragon war to protect and defend eggs and hatchlings. The firemaids have three oaths: the first, taken as drakkas, to serve; the second, upon reaching maturity, to secure an official position within the ranks; and finally the third oath, taken when dragonelles are ready to devote themselves entirely to the organization, a vow of chastity. Wistala and Lada become members for a brief time. 1016:: A family of bats that assist The Copper in exchange for his blood, and his saving their lives. They accompany him to the Lavadome where they act as a spy and messenger force for him, and later the Lavadome. After a few generations of feeding almost entirely on dragons blood several bats become large and almost dragon-like, earning the nickname gargoyles. 1083:: The ruler of Ghioz and commander of a powerful alliance of outlying forces.
